Ingredients:
- 8 oz (about 225g) of your favorite pasta (linguine, fettuccine, or spaghetti work well)
- 1 pound (about 450g) mixed seafood (shrimp, scallops, mussels, and/or clams), cleaned and deveined
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 cup chicken or seafood broth
- 1/2 cup dry white wine
- Juice of half a lemon
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Crushed red pepper flakes (optional, for a bit of heat)
-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
Instructions:
- Cook the pasta: Boil a large pot of salted water and cook the pasta according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
- Prepare the seafood: In a large skillet or pan,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ium-high heat. Add the mixed seafood and sauté until just cooked through. This should only take a few minutes, as overcooking can result in rubbery seafood. Remove the cooked seafood from the pan and set aside.
- Make the garlic butter sauce: In the same pan, add the remaining 2 tablespoons of butter.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1-2 minutes until fragrant, being careful not to burn it. If you like a bit of heat, you can add a pinch of crushed red pepper flakes.
- Deglaze the pan: Pour in the white wine and chicken or seafood broth, scraping any browned bits from the bottom of the pan. Allow the liquid to simmer and reduce by half.
- Combine everything: Add the cooked seafood back to the pan, along with the cooked pasta. Toss everything together to coat the pasta and seafood in the garlic butter sauce. Squeeze the lemon juice over the mixture and season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ve: Garnish the seafood pasta with chopped fresh parsley and serve immediately. You can also add a bit of grated Parmesan cheese if desired.
